Have you ever been tempted to write your story down? Prose and poetry can be the perfect format to capture the complexities and nuance of personal narrative.

Sisters Rangimarie and Caitlin Jolley (Waikato Tainui) are creators of the Hoki Mai exhibition, curated by Kūwao Gallery. In this session, you'll hear about how they use words and images to explore the power of reconnecting to their whakapapa.

Rangimarie will then take you through an easy, simple introduction to Prose101, after which you might have a go at writing a short piece of 5-10 lines.
